IltmfCapture::get_Balance

Summary

Retrieves the balance for the audio stream .

Syntax

#include "ltmf.h"

Language Syntax
C HRESULT IltmfCapture_get_Balance(pCapture, pBalance)
C++ HRESULT get_Balance(pBalance)

Parameters

IltmfCapture *pCapture

Pointer to an IltmfCapture interface.

long *pBalance

Pointer to a variable to be updated with the balance value. Possible values range from -10000 to 10000, where -10000 indicates that the right channel is receiving no signal, 10000 indicates that the left channel is receiving no signal, and 0 indicates that both channels are getting the same amount of the audio signal.

Returns

Value Meaning
S_OK The function was successful.
<> S_OK An error occurred. Refer to the Error Codes.

Comments

Units correspond to .01 decibels (multiplied by 1 when pVal is a positive value). For example, a value of 1000 indicates 10 dB on the right channel and 90 dB on the left channel.

Audio stream

The portion of the file holding the audio data. The audio data might be compressed to save disk space. The data has to be decompressed using an audio decompressor before you can play (hear) it.

Audio decompressor

Software component which decompresses audio. It must be designed to work with ACM or DirectShow. Note that different compression methods require different decompressors. There is no universal decompressor capable of decoding all compressed streams.
